Menstrual Cycle
What is menstrual cycle ?
Menstrual cycle is periodic onset of menstruation. The discharge of blood from woman's body once in every 28 days is known as menstruation. 

Vata dosha is responsible for this downward movement of menstruation every month. Pitta dosha is responsible for blood quantity and cleansing. Kapha dosha is related with mucus, fluid and tissues present in the menstruation.

Monthly menstrual cycle should be considered as the health Advantage, as the whole body gets purified at this time. Ayurveda especially views menstruation as a uniquely female physiological function intimate to the health and happiness of women during their childbearing years. It keeps the body mind prepared for reproduction. Beyond reproduction it also gives a regular opportunity for women to eliminate the accumulated Ama or waste products which has the potential to create disease. 

For many women menstruation is a common normal easy monthly elimination but for some others, it is a time of intense pain, emotional upsets and debility. The main causes of getting difficulties in menstruation are - 

  • Improper diet, 
  • Improper daily routines, 
  • Irregular sleeping times, 
  • Lack of exercises, 
  • Stressful environment. 

Because of all these reasons the bodily doshas get imbalanced. The digestive fire diminishes, Ama consumption starts. This Ama is the excess metabolic waste created during the month. Menstrual cramps, diarrhea, nausea,
heavy flow are more likely to occur during your period if your body requires increasing cleansing for Ama elimination. As these symptoms are Ama related, you may feel light and enthusiastic after your menstrual period is over,  though it is difficult for you in menstruating days.

AYURVEDIC prescription for comfortable menstruation - 
1) Stay inward - It is time for rejuvenation Pay more attention to your body. This will help to minimize discomfort and irritability.
2) Take diet - light and warm. Freshly prepared food is favorable. AVOID - cold drinks and carbonated beverages, fried food, cheese and yogurt.
3) Rest - Plan to take 2/3 days off each month for rest. Try to avoid staying late at night. Resting doesn't mean lying in bed unless pain or cramps are worse. Rest can be doing lighter scheduled activities in the home or outside as per requirement. If possible, do light enjoyable activities around the house such as reading, writing, etc. Avoid sleeping in day time.
4) Keep exercise easy - 20 to 30 min walk each day is enough exercise during period.
5) Sexual activity  should be avoided.
6) Abhyanga (Oil massage) - should be avoided for first 3 days of period.

PMS and Menstrual problems 

What is PMS?
PMS- Premenstrual Syndrome is a complex of symptoms occurring 7 to 10 days before the on set of each menstrual cycle.

The symptoms of PMS
Physical Symptoms – Headache, fluid retention, migraine, fatigue, painful joints constipation, backache, abdominal cramping, heart palpitation, weight gain.

Emotional and Behavioral Changes – Depression, Anxiety irritability, tension, panic attacks, lack of coordination, altered libido, decreased work performance

Causes
1. Improper diet and daily routine
2. Hormonal imbalance
3. Stress etc.


Management of PMS
Eat 5-6 times in a day regular 3-4 hour intervals. The food should be light, warm and freshly prepared. Semisolid or liquid diet like soups and juices are helpful Reduce the use of alcohol, salt, caffeine, fats and white sugar.

Exercise is helpful as it reduces stress and tension. It acts as mood elevator, provides a sense of well being & improves blood circulation

1. Ayurvedic purification procedures and allied treatments are very useful.  

2. Ayurvedic herbal supplements and medicated oils are useful.

MENOPAUSE

Menopause means ceassion of menstruation.This marks a major transition in women's biological life as she moves from the time of life dominated by Pitta to that dominated Vata dosha.

Occurance of menopausal symptoms is a reflection of imbalance in the doshas (VATA-PITTA-AND KAPH) and buildup of metabolic wastes (Ama) which are responsible for disturbing the tissue metabolism.

Following signs showing increase in Vata dosha often starts to increase around menopause -

  • Constipation

  • Thinner and Drier skin

  • Drier mucous membrane

  • Some thining of hair

  • Some thining of bones

  • Lighter and more interrpted sleep 

  • An increased tendency to worry.

Imbalanced Pitta dosha can also play a part in menopausal symptoms...

Pitta regulates hormonal balance, heat production and tissue metabolism in the physiology. During menstruating years excess buildup of Ama gets eliminated with the menstrual flow. When menopause occurs this excess Ama can not be eliminated and gets involved in the phenomenon of hot flashes, with vitiated Pitta dosha.

Ayurvedic prescription for comfortable menopause includes - 

  • Regular body cleansing procedures
  • Daily oil massage
  • Consistent exercise
  • Regular rest routine 
  • Proper diet 

Practice a stress reduction technique - which enables your physiology to get connected with your inner - intelligence the deepest level of your own self from where the process of healing starts. 

Menopausal purification programs specially designed for menopausal symptoms, includes all above prescription points with personalized allied Panchakarma treatments.

OSTEOPOROSIS

Osteoporosis is bone thinning condition which accelerates the body’s normal bone loss. Although your skeleton may seem solid, the inside of your bones are actually riddled with tiny cavities like a petrified sponge. The body is constantly adding new tissues while it remove older one. But as your age, your bone becomes sparser and breaks down more rapidly than before .That change create weak brittle bones leading to back pain increased risk of broken bones and posture problems.

Osteoporosis is a preventable condition and you can slow down the process of bone loss and prevent it with diet, exercise, Ayurvedic herbs and detoxification procedures (Panchakarma). 

Risk increasing factors -
1) At least 4 times as many women as men develop osteoporosis.
2) In postmenopausal women, it is more often found.
3) Excessive exercise which interrupts menstruation.
4) Family history of the same.
5) If you are having delicate body structure and slender build.
6) Cigarette smoking or alcohol can block the calcium absorption and reduce bone growth.
7) Long term treatments with the some anti – inflammatory drugs can diminish bone growth.


Treatments

1) Keep up calcium intake as per necessity 

Dairy products – milk, yogurt, paneer, cheese

Vegetables - broccoli, sardines, collards, turnip greens

Nuts - Almond

Fruits --- Orange, grape fruit, apple juice

2) Exercise regularly
A weight bearing activity such as dancing, climbing stairs, walking represents the ideal bone saving regimen as this activities helps to retain the calcium. It also takes care of hip bones and vertebral which are prone to fractures.

Avoid the following the activity -
Spine jarring activities such as high impact aerobics, jumping ropes or jogging. Sit ups toe touches, use of trampolines should be avoided.

3) Prevent a fall 
Do not exercise on slippery floors. Make a your home fall free. Wear shoes with arch support and non skid soles.

4) Get some sun – light 
The sunshine vitamins ‘D’ builds bones by increasing the body’s calcium absorption. A daily 15 min. walk outside in sun is usually enough to produce vit. D necessary for your body.

5) Ayurvedic herbal supplements like medicinal herbal pastes are useful, certain herbs, green leafy vegetables wheat and blackgram help to build up bone tissues. 

Panchakarma Treatment help to strengthen the bone tissue and thro purification procedures help to prevent further bone tissue loss.
